About This Book
Paisley, a cuddly stuffed elephant, dreams of finding a special friend to share adventures with beyond the toy store shelves. Join Paisley as he explores new places and hopes to find the perfect companion to play with and cherish.

Why we rated Paisley 7C
Paisley is written at a Level 2-3 reading level (approximately 394 words). Strong independent readers around grade 3.9 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Paisley works for readers up to grade 4.9.
Read aloud, Paisley takes about 3 minutes, which fits within a single read-aloud session.
We rate Paisley as 7C ("Clear") because the content sits in the "Gentle" range — no conflict beyond everyday childhood experiences.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ly gentle; no single dimension stands out as a concern.
No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the gentle intensity score.
Thematically, Paisley explores toys, friendship, adventure, and animals —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
